Abstract
The invention discloses a peanut oil production technology. The peanut oil production technology comprises specific steps as follows: S1: preparation of peanuts, S2: pretreatment of the peanuts, S3: drying of the peanuts, S4: cooling of the peanuts, S5: hulling of the peanuts, S6: stir-frying and decrustation of the peanuts, S7: crushing of the peanuts, S8: squeezing to form cakes, S9: oil pressing and collecting, and S10: purification and filtration of the peanut oil. The water content in the peanuts is strictly controlled, the maximum peanut oil yield is realized, waste residues produced in the pressing process and in the filtration process are repeatedly pressed, the use rate of the peanuts is increased, wastes produced in the operation process are reutilized, waste gas is discharged after being treated, hot gas produced during drying passes by a water tank through a gas pipe to be reutilized, and resources are not wasted.

Summary of the invention
It is an object of the invention to provide the production technology of a kind of Oleum Arachidis hypogaeae semen, with the problem solving to propose in above-mentioned background technology.
For achieving the above object, the present invention provides following technical scheme: the production technology of a kind of Oleum Arachidis hypogaeae semen, the production technology of this Oleum Arachidis hypogaeae semen specifically comprises the following steps that
Getting the raw materials ready of S1: Semen arachidis hypogaeae, commercially chooses peanut raw material, makes the water content of Semen arachidis hypogaeae less than 5%, and the kernel-containing rate of Semen arachidis hypogaeae is not less than 95%;
The pretreatment of S2: Semen arachidis hypogaeae, is cleaned out by impurity such as the Radix Platycodonis in the peanut raw material that the equipment such as blower fan, stone mill will be purchased in S1, sandstone, it is to avoid affect peanut oil squeezing quality, prevents the impurity such as earth, sandstone from machine is produced injury;
The drying of S3: Semen arachidis hypogaeae, dries the peanut raw material after pretreated in S2;
The cooling of S4: Semen arachidis hypogaeae, uses air-cooled method, quickly the temperature of Semen arachidis hypogaeae in S3 is cooled to 20-30 DEG C, and steam by water tank, is recycled by the steam of generation by trachea;
The shelling of S5: Semen arachidis hypogaeae, is removed the Semen arachidis hypogaeae after cooling in S4 the shell of Semen arachidis hypogaeae by hulling machine, utilizes screening plant to be separated with Semen arachidis hypogaeae by Pericarppium arachidis hypogaeae, recycled by Pericarppium arachidis hypogaeae, by Semen arachidis hypogaeae centralized collection;
Stir-frying and peeling of S6: Semen arachidis hypogaeae, stir-fries to the Semen arachidis hypogaeae collected in S5, makes the outside of Semen arachidis hypogaeae slough, and under the effect of blower fan, makes Semen arachidis hypogaeae and crust depart from;
Pulverizing of S7: Semen arachidis hypogaeae, utilizes crusher to be pulverized by the Semen arachidis hypogaeae peeled in S6;
S8: be squeezed into ingot, carries out extrusion process to the Semen arachidis hypogaeae pulverized in S7 is unqualified, is squeezed into ingot, it is simple to following process;
S9: extract oil and collect, is extracted oil to the raw material being squeezed into ingot in S8 by oil press, and collects the waste residue of Oleum Arachidis hypogaeae semen and the generation squeezed;
The purification of S10: Oleum Arachidis hypogaeae semen and filtration, purify the Oleum Arachidis hypogaeae semen collected in S9 and filter, and removes the precipitated impurities in oil and solid granule, and carries out back precipitated impurities and solid granule squeezing, farthest utilizes Oleum Arachidis hypogaeae semen.
Preferably, the water content in described S3 Semen arachidis hypogaeae is maintained at 3%-4%.
Preferably, described step S4 is installed filtering and purifying at the steam vent of air cooler, it is to avoid the dust pollution air of generation.
Compared with prior art, the invention has the beneficial effects as follows: the present invention strictly controls water content in Semen arachidis hypogaeae, farthest realize the oil yield of Semen arachidis hypogaeae, the waste residue produced in the waste residue produced in expressing process and filter process being repeated squeezing, improves the utilization rate of Semen arachidis hypogaeae, the waste material produced in operating process recycles, discharge after waste gas is processed, it is dried the steam produced by trachea by water tank, steam is recycled, does not waste resource.
